Шаг 4 - Обновление информации в активной странице

В предыдущем шаге наша страница начала выводить информацию из таблицы базы данных. Если вы измените информацию в таблице, то, рано или поздно, столкнетесь с тем, что наша (Ваша) страница отображает изменения "через раз". Это связано с тем, что информация в Internet кэшируется серверами. В свое время, с решением этого вопроса мне помог мой знакомый Влад. Я о нем упоминал в Шаге 1.

Добавим в самом начале нашей страницы две строки. Не забудем включить их в тэг <% %>:

<%@ Language=VBScript %>

<%
Response.Expires = 0
Response.AddHeader "pragma", "no-cache"
%>

<HTML>
<HEAD>
......

Об объекте Response мы поговорим позже. Сейчас самое важное, что после сохранения кода наша страница всегда и сразу отображает изменения информации в таблице базы данных. Шаг у нас получился небольшой, но очень важный.


Предыдущий Шаг | Следующий Шаг | Оглавление
Автор Сергей Платонов - 26.01.2000